HA2 8PE is a small residential postcode in England, home to 1605 people. This compact area is defined by its cluster of homes, offering a quiet, community-focused environment. The median age of 47 suggests a stable population, with adults aged 30-64 forming the largest demographic group. The area’s character is shaped by its predominantly Asian population, reflecting cultural diversity in local traditions and community life. Daily life here is underpinned by practical connectivity: residents benefit from nearby rail and metro stations, including Northolt Park and Sudbury Hill, ensuring easy access to London’s transport network. The proximity to RAF Northolt and Kew Pier adds a layer of convenience for commuters and leisure activities. With low flood risk and a safety score of 75, HA2 8PE balances security with accessibility. Its small size means the area feels intimate, with amenities like Asda and Aldi within walking distance. HA2 8PE is primarily an owner-occupied area, with 72% of residents living in homes they own. This high rate of home ownership points to a market where property is viewed as a long-term investment, rather than a transient rental option. The accommodation type is predominantly houses, which aligns with the area’s focus on family homes and private living.
